**Changelog — Quillfen Functions runtime v1.9**

Changed cold-start defaults. Pre-warm pool raised from 2 to 6 instances per handler. Snapshot restore enabled by default; lazy dependency loading now on for all runtimes. Init timeout cut from 60s to 20s to surface slow handlers early. These apply to all new deployments; existing stacks inherit on next redeploy. For reference, the defaults as shipped in this release are listed below.

deployment values, yadug-bawif:
[framir]
team = pelox
access_code = ac_a38ab2
owner = tamion.julael
host = framir.tolvaqlabs.test
port = 11211
peer = tammir.zemvargrid.local
salt = 2215ef03
pin = 1541

Capacity note for the Bramblewick export retry queue. Failed exports are requeued with exponential backoff, and the queue depth is our main capacity signal: sustained depth above the high-water mark means downstream Pellis storage is saturated, not that we need more workers. As the new contractor, please don't raise worker counts without checking storage latency first — it usually makes things worse. Retry timing, backoff caps, and the high-water threshold are all driven by the constants shown below.

limits module of yagef-bajog:
TIERS = {
    "druael": 370,
    "tamix": 286,
    "pelius": 541,
    "pelael": 78,
    "pelox": 47,
    "ralath": 533,
    "drumir": 801,
}

Handover: TidySweep bot, for your review.

Runs with a scoped service account — delete rights on branches only, nothing on tags or default branches. Dry-run mode is enforced in prod until the allowlist check passes. Audit log ships to Kestrel. Permissions matrix, token rotation schedule, and past review findings are on the internal page below.

operations page: https://jenkins.zemvarcloud.local/job/merge_requests/repo/build/73930b4b30f0a8ed

**Audit item 14: Flag rollout framework (Driftgate)**
Verify: every flag has an expiry date and a cleanup ticket; percentage rollouts log exposure events; kill-switch path tested in staging within the last 30 days; no orphaned flags older than two quarters; config changes require two approvals. Current status: three stale flags found in the checkout module, cleanup pending; kill-switch drill overdue by one week. Evidence links attached to the audit folder. Remediation is due before next sync, and the accountable owner is recorded below.

account owner for bawip-tahag: Raleth Quenok